Batt. Keeps Dying..
Everytime i park my car and turn off "EVERYTHING" and came back the next day or 2 the Batt. is dead.. and its keep saying my door is Ajar but its not. Along with the seat belt light keeps flashing... so lost on this one... Help please?

Re: Batt. Keeps Dying..
I too have the same problem, but None of my warning lights come on.. I was reading that to identify the problem, you can pull a few fuses each night ad try to narrow down the draw that way.. the only problem with this is that if the draw is before the fusebox.. it wont work.. I will try this as soon as I start daily driving my hatch again.. but in the mean time I hope this helps =]
